Arkansas State Bowling Takes Third Place in Prairie View Invitational

ARLINGTON, Texas. (2/3/13) – The Arkansas State women’s bowling team took home third place in the Prairie View A&M Invitational on Sunday. The Red Wolves went 10-3 on the weekend and improved to 45-18 on the season.

A-State dropped its first match of the day 4-1 to Prairie View A&M in the last round-robin match despite knocking down more pins total. ASU entered the bracket play as the No. 1 seed and played the No. 4 seed Nebraska. The Red Wolves were defeated by Nebraska 4-3 and fell to the third place game against Vanderbilt. Arkansas State lost the first two games of the match, but rallied to win four in a row to capture third place.

“Losing to Prairie View was unfortunate because of the format,” ASU bowling coach Justin Kostick said. “We took Nebraska to seven games in a really good match and did really well to come back and win third place against Vanderbilt. 10-3 on the weekend is good with some really impressive wins over ranked teams and we really dominated this tournament. Congrats to Ashley Rucker for making the all-tournament team and it was big for her and Sarah Lokker to perform as well as they did in front of Team USA coaches.”

A-State returns to action Feb. 15-17 in the Morgan State Invitational at Baltimore, Md.
